Our Installation Process in Marco Island
Free On-Site Evaluation
We inspect your slab, test for moisture, and measure the area.
Diamond Grinding
Mechanical prep to CSP 2-3 profile — never acid etching.
Repairs & Moisture Barrier
Cracks filled and MVB primer applied when testing requires it.
System Installation
100% solids epoxy base with your chosen finish.
UV-Stable Topcoat
Aliphatic polyaspartic sealer — most floors ready in 24 hours.

See full warranty detailsGeneral Pricing
Most residential systems range from $5–15 per sq ft depending on the system.
Pricing varies based on square footage, concrete condition, moisture, existing coatings, repairs, access, selected system and project requirements. A site evaluation may be required for final pricing.
